Transaction 7759b611a33b196db539dd5c2eb7ae10bb3c22ee2bdf3401580549435d619582
1 Input
1 Output
-
7759b611a33b196db539dd5c2eb7ae10bb3c22ee2bdf3401580549435d619582:0
- value
- 568941
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ad1ca4a6a0a573dee31f3b2076f02cb62a0119d
- address
- bc1qftgu5jn2pftnmm337weqwmczed32qyvavlesnz